Cache is located on Pennsylvania Game Lands. Please follow all game
laws and wear orange during the hunting seasons. Be sure to visit
the great vista here: 41 18.480N, 078 50.513W; it is along a gas
well road that splits north from the main road, SE of the cache
site.
The geocache hidden at the posted coordinates is a regular
geocache, however, it is also part of the Allegheny GeoTrail (AGT),
a publicly funded project designed to promote a pleasant and
positive experience and image of the Allegheny National Forest
region and its gateway communities. The AGT utilizes the growing
interest in geocaching to assist both residents and visitors to the
area in learning more about the unique attractions in the ten
participating counties. This cache contains a unique self inking
rubber stamp which you should use to stamp your Allegheny GeoTrail
Passport to verify that you found it. When you have found a minimum
of six AGT caches, you will be eligible to have your AGT passport
validated and receive a commemorative AGT trackable geocoin at
participating locations. You must have your official AGT passport
with you when you find this cache in order to stamp it. Click on
the Allegheny GeoTrail Logo below to visit the AGT website at
www.alleghenygeotrail.com for complete details and a listing of
participating locations where you may pick up and validate AGT
passports to receive your souvenir geocoin, trackable at
www.geocaching.com .
(This will be about a 5 mile journey round trip. It is a
very pleasant bike ride from the Gate on Empire Ridge Road. Parking
Coordinates are N 41 17.569 W078 52.457. The gate is open during
the hunting season. I believe that they lock the gates back up in
January. If gate is open you can park at N41 18138 W078 51.509.
This will cut the trip in half. You will be taking the road at the
second parking area. Motor vehicles are prohibited on the road so
please respect this. It is not a hard walk or bike ride. There are
only a couple small hills. Skiing to the cache in the winter months
would be enjoyable. There are lots of tall oaks and food plots
along the road. No bushwhacking is needed; The cache is only about
25 ft from the road. If you make the journey you will be glad.
.)
